System operation
HUD system displays various information on the windshield glass which
minimizes the driver’s eye movement to enhance safety and convenience.
The Head Up Display reflects the TFT LCD images to two mirrors (flat/concave)
and displays them 2.32m ahead from the driver's eye.

Ambient Light Sensor
Ambient light sensor: The two-direction (horizontal, vertical) measuring
sensor is applied and the HUD brightness is adjusted by the horizontal
measurements.
